+ # activerecord-bulkwrite
4
+ Bulk write/upsert for ActiveRecord!
5
+
6
+ # Requirement
7
+ PostgreSQL 9.5 and higher
8
+
9
+ # Installation
10
+
11
+ ```
12
+ gem install activerecord-bulkwrite
13
+ ```
14
+
15
+ # Usage
16
+
17
+ Suppose a table definition:
18
+
19
+ ```ruby
20
+ create table users (
21
+ id integer primary key,
22
+ name text,
23
+ hireable bool,
24
+ created_at date_time,
25
+ foo text,
26
+ bar text,
27
+ )
28
+ ```
29
+
30
+ ## Bulk Insert
31
+
32
+ ```ruby
33
+ require "activerecord/bulkwrite"
34
+
35
+ fields = %w(id name hireable created_at)
36
+ rows = [
37
+ [1, "Bob's", true, Time.now.utc],
38
+ [2, nil, "false", Time.now.utc.iso8601],
39
+ # ...
40
+ ]
41
+
42
+ # The result is the effected(inserted) rows.
43
+ result = User.bulk_write(fields, rows)
44
+ ```
45
+
46
+ The values of rows are sent to database as-is, and their to_s method is called when necessary. So here you need to *pay attention to datetime values: it must be in UTC time, not in local time*, since there's no time zone conversion.
47
+
48
+ ## Bulk Upsert
49
+
50
+ You do upsert like:
51
+
52
+ ```ruby
53
+ result = User.bulk_write(fields, rows, :conflict => [:id])
54
+ ```
55
+
56
+ The statement above reinserted `rows` and thus failed on unique violation. But this time we specified an `:conflict` option meaning when the given fields conflict then do update with the rest fields. We can also explicitly specify the fields to update:
57
+
58
+ ```ruby
59
+ result = User.bulk_write(fields, rows, :conflict => [:id], :update => %w(name created_at))
60
+ ```
61
+
62
+ We can even specify conditions under which to do update:
63
+
64
+ ```ruby
65
+ result = User.bulk_write(fields, rows, :conflict => [:id], :where => "users.hireable = TRUE"))
66
+ ```
67
+
68
+ The upsert function depends on PostgreSQL 9.5's upsert. See here for more: https://www.postgresql.org/docs/9.5/static/sql-insert.html#SQL-ON-CONFLICT
69
+
70
+ # Compatible Rails Versions and Test
71
+ It's tested against ActiveRecord 4.2, but should also work on 4.x as well as 5.
